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$566 per month in Ternopil vs $683 in Kharkiv, rent included.

A couple spends around $908 per month in Ternopil vs $1,081 in Kharkiv, rent included.

A family of three spends $1,251 per month in Ternopil vs $1,480 in Kharkiv, rent included.

Ternopil is about 17% cheaper than Kharkiv,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both Ternopil and Kharkiv are more affordable than the global median โ€“ Ternopil 58% lower, Kharkiv 49% lower.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$263 in Ternopil versus $186 in Kharkiv.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 5% higher in Ternopil, which reinforces the cost advantage โ€“ you earn more and spend less. Purchasing power leans clearly in its favor.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$19 in Ternopil versus $27 in Kharkiv.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$132 vs $153 โ€“ making Ternopil the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
